How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Branchdale?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Branchdale Studio Apartments | $1,227 | $995 | $1,500 |
Branchdale 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,858 | $965 | $4,029 |
Branchdale 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,995 | $299 | $4,849 |
Branchdale 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,047 | $339 | $5,523 |
Branchdale 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,080 | $1,990 | $2,175 |

Cheapest Available Branchdale and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ments
As of July 05,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Branchdale, PA is the 1 BR 1 BA Model starting from $895 at Apollo Point Apartments . The second most affordable Branchdale 1 Bedroom is the Suite w/ Private Bath Model at 401 Lightstreet starting at $971 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Branchdale is currently $1,858.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Branchdale:
